A new report from the Yale Center for Business and the Environment, in partnership with the Connecticut Green Bank, provides a comprehensive analysis of the feasibility of design and financing for Green Resilience Hubs (GRH). Green Resilience Hubs are physical facilities equipped … technologies and strategically located to offer vital services to local communities before, during, and after emergencies such as natural disasters.
